Generalization
The ability to apply the lessons learned from specific instances to broader, similar situations without being explicitly taught for every situation.
Positive Reinforcement
A process in behavior analysis where the probability of a behavior occurring is increased by following it with the addition of a reinforcing stimulus.
Negative Reinforcement
A behavior modification technique that involves the removal of an unpleasant stimulus to increase the likelihood of a desired response.
Learned Helplessness
A condition in which a person suffers from a sense of powerlessness, arising from a traumatic event or persistent failure to succeed. It is thought to be one of the underlying causes of depression.
